When a covalent compound dissolves in a liquid, the compound's molecules are surrounded and separated by the solvent molecules. This disrupts the intermolecular forces within the compound and allows the solvent molecules to interact with the compound's molecules. Ultimately, the compound disperses evenly throughout the solvent, forming a homogeneous solution.

When a compound held together by ionic bonds dissolves in water, the ionic bonds are broken and the compound dissociates into its constituent ions. These ions are then surrounded by water molecules, which stabilize them and prevent them from re-forming the solid compound.

The separation of ions when an ionic compound dissolves in a solution is known as dissociation. In this process, the ionic compound breaks apart into its constituent ions in the aqueous solution due to the interaction with the solvent molecules.

Water serves primarily as a solvent in living cells where most molecules and ions are dissolved. Its unique properties, such as polarity and ability to hydrogen bond, allow it to dissolve a wide variety of substances necessary for cellular processes.
